Using user segments for targeted content

US2016358206A1 · US · A1

Patent metadata
FieldValue
Publication numberUS-2016358206-A1
Application numberUS-201514728354-A
CountryUS
Kind codeA1
Filing dateJun 2, 2015
Priority dateJun 2, 2015
Publication dateDec 8, 2016
Grant date

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

Techniques for providing content to a computing device of a user are described. For example, a platform hosts a plurality of tools includes an analytics tool and a content tool. Input of a customer of the platform is received and specifies user segments and content to be provided accordingly. The tools are updated based on the customer input. User interactions of the user are also received and analyzed by, for example, the analytics tool. The analytics tool outputs an indication that the user is associated with a user segment based on the analysis. The output identifies the user segment and the user based on a format usable by the other tools. In turn, the content tool automatically receives and uses the output as an input to determine the content and the target of the content. Accordingly, the content tool provides the content to the computing device of the user.

First claim

Opening claim text (preview).

1 . In a computing platform having an analytics tool configured to analyze interactions of users with published content and a separate content tool configured to provide targeted content to the users, a computer-implemented method comprising: receiving, by the analytics tool, information identifying one or more user interactions of a user using a computing device to interact with the published content; automatically triggering, based on receiving the information identifying the one or more user interactions, the analytics tool to associate the user with a user segment based on analyzing the information identifying the one or more user interactions; and automatically triggering, based on associating the user with the user segment, the analytics tool to provide information identifying that the user is associated with the user segment to the content tool, wherein the content tool is configured to provide targeted content to the computing device of the user based on receiving the information identifying that the user is associated with the user segment. 2 . The computer-implemented method of claim 1 , further comprising updating the analytics tool and the content tool to use a common identifier of the user segment, wherein the information identifying that the user is associated with the user segment comprises the common identifier. 3 . The computer-implemented method of claim 1 , wherein the analytics tool and the content tool are configured to use a common identifier of the user segment and a common identifier of the user, and wherein the information identifying that the user is associated with the user segment comprises the common identifier of the user segment and the common identifier of the user. 4 . The computer-implemented method of claim 1 , wherein the published content is available from a web site that embeds a beacon for tracking the user interactions, wherein the targeted content comprises an advertisement to be inserted in another web site accessed by the computing device of the user. 5 . The computer-implemented method of claim 1 , wherein the platform comprises a cloud-based service for hosting a plurality of tools comprising the analytics tool and the content tool. 6 . The computer-implemented method of claim 1 , wherein the platform comprises an internal communication bus configured to interconnect the analytics tool and the content tool, and wherein the information identifying that the user is associated with the user is published from the analytics tool to the content tool over the internal communication bus. 7 . The computer-implemented method of claim 1 , wherein the information identifying that the user is associated with the user is published from the analytics tool to the content tool over an internal communication bus, and further comprising: generating metadata based on an input of a customer of the platform, wherein the metadata comprises a common identifier of user segment, parameters for associating the user with the user segments based on the user interactions, and a definition of an action to be performed to determine the targeted content; and providing the metadata to the analytics tool and the content tool based on respective application programming interfaces of the analytics tool and the content tool, wherein the respective application programming interfaces are separate from the internal communication bus. 8 . The computer-implemented method of claim 1 , wherein the analytics tool and the content tool are configured to use a cookie uniquely assigned to the computing device of the user, and wherein the information identifying that the user is associated with the user segment comprises the cookie. 9 . A computer-readable medium comprising instructions that, when executed on a computing system associated with a platform hosting an analytics tool and a content tool to a customer, cause the computing system to at least: receive input of the customer defining a user segment for the analytics tool and defining an action for the content tool to perform based on the user segment; receive information identifying user interactions of a user using a computing device to interact with the published content; cause the analytics tool to analyze the information identifying the user interactions based on the input of the customer defining the user segment and to associate the user with the user segment based on the analyzing; and cause, based on associating the user with the user segment, the analytics tool to provide information identifying that the user is associated with the user segment to the content tool, wherein the content tool is configured to automatically perform the action based on receiving the information identifying that the user is associated with the user segment. 10 . The computer-readable medium of claim 9 , wherein the instructions, when executed on the computing system, further configure the computing system to provide an interface configured to receive the input of the customer from a computing device of the customer. 11 . The computer-readable medium of claim 9 , wherein the user segment indicates an interest common to a plurality of users, and wherein performing the action comprises selecting and providing an advertisement based on the interest to the computing device of the user. 12 . The computer-readable medium of claim 9 , wherein the analytics tool and the content tool comprise respective application programming interfaces configured to receive metadata associated with the input of the customer, wherein the metadata comprises a common identifier of the user segment and causes the analytics tool and the content tool to be updated to the use the common identifier to identify the user segment. 13 . The computer-readable medium of claim 12 , wherein the platform comprises an internal communication bus configured to interconnect the analytics tool and the content tool, and wherein the information identifying that the user is associated with the user segment is exchanged between the analytics tool and the content tool over the internal communication bus. 14 . The computer-readable medium of claim 13 , wherein the instructions, when executed on the computing system, further configure the computing system to: associate the user interactions with an identifier of the computing device of the user; and store the user interactions and the identifier in a data store of the platform, wherein the analytics tool and the content tool have access to the data store. 15 . A system associated with a platform hosting an analytics tool and a content tool, the computing system comprising: one or more processors; one or more computer-readable media communicatively coupled to the one or more processors and bearing instructions that, upon execution by the one or more processors, cause the system to at least: provide an interface to a computing device of a customer, wherein the interface is configured to facilitate customer input specifying a user segment for the analytics tool and indicating content for the content tool based on the user segment; receive information identifying user interactions of a user using a computing device to interact with the published content; trigger the analytics tool to analyze the information identifying user interactions based on the input of the customer specifying the user segment and to associate the user with the user segment based on the analyzing; and trigger, based on associating the user with the user segment, the analytics tool to provide information identifying that the user is associated with the user segment to the content tool, wherei

Assignees

Inventors

Classifications

  • based on user history · CPC title

  • Online advertisement · CPC title

  • Surveys · CPC title

  • for the control of specific functions or operations, e.g. selecting or manipulating an object, an image or a displayed text element, setting a parameter value or selecting a range · CPC title

  • based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US2016358206A1 cover?
Techniques for providing content to a computing device of a user are described. For example, a platform hosts a plurality of tools includes an analytics tool and a content tool. Input of a customer of the platform is received and specifies user segments and content to be provided accordingly. The tools are updated based on the customer input. User interactions of the user are also received and …
Who is the assignee on this patent?
Adobe Systems Inc
What technology area does this patent fall under?
Primary CPC classification G06Q30/0245. Mapped technology areas include Physics.
When was this patent published?
Publication date Thu Dec 08 2016 00:00:00 GMT+0000 (Coordinated Universal Time) (A1).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 8 related publications on this page (citations in our corpus or others sharing the same primary CPC).